    What Will You Enjoy Doing

    Quality System


    • Ensures compliance with all quality management system requirements (ISO 9001,
    FSSC 22000 and other standards as required)
    • Primary practitioner for HACCP program (as applicable); supports any additional risk
    assessment requirements including change management
    • Prepares and successfully completes internal and external quality and/or food safety
    audits
    • Monthly reporting of quality and food safety system data per documented corporate
    procedures locally as well as regionally as required
    Quality Control
    • Ensure production compliance with all regulatory, internal and customer product
    and packaging specifications; ensures customer specifications are current and
    accessible
    • Ensure customer mandated compliance documents are issued (i.e. COAs, regulatory
    statements)
    • Oversite responsibility for plant quality control program including product
    measurement/testing and data collection and integrity and rework management
    • Oversite for performance of quality test equipment including internal and external
    calibration programs
    • Assist operations in new product (AQP) and equipment qualification and verification
    activities
    • Assist in optimizing and standardizing plant quality documentation including
    utilization of standard document control systems
    • Documents and reports all supplier quality related issues per standard procedures;
    supports Logistics team on securing complaint resolution


    Customer Relationship Management

    • Hosts periodic customer visits; primary contact for quality and regulatory related
    communications with customer
    • Manages customer complaint process including application of proper RCA
    techniques and tools. Ensures customer complaints are captured in
    global/regional/local reporting systems
    • Supports the RCA process and training for other departments in the plant


    Laboratory Management
    • Ensures all personnel performing quality testing within the quality lab and on the
    production floor are trained and qualified
    • Leading the Team
    o Regularly scheduled quality staff meeting
    o Ensures team works together as efficiently as possible
    o Ensures correctly time and attendance of team is captured
    o Recruits (with HR) new employees
    o Performs disciplinary actions
    o Performs annual performance evaluations
    o Assesses training needs of staff and ensures execution of training
